Greenfield Reservoir Details

Greenfield Reservoir is a very small freshwater lake in Greater Manchester, situated at an altitude of around 271 meters and is shallow.

The shoreline of Greenfield Reservoir is approximately 0.922 Kilometers all the way round.

  • Altitude: 271 m
  • Shoreline: 0.922 Km
  • Depth: Shallow
